[x265] [PATCH 3 of 3] correct register num in intrapred8.asm

Min Chen chenm003 at 163.com
Fri Apr 25 05:02:11 CEST 2014


# HG changeset patch
# User Min Chen <chenm003 at 163.com>
# Date 1398394916 -28800
# Node ID 3f8bcd1ea55aa2f93486b4ee02184ac48981d8b9
# Parent  89875c3fdaf689c4e0d7488264dbda6eed266326
correct register num in intrapred8.asm

diff -r 89875c3fdaf6 -r 3f8bcd1ea55a source/common/x86/intrapred8.asm
--- a/source/common/x86/intrapred8.asm	Fri Apr 25 11:01:36 2014 +0800
+++ b/source/common/x86/intrapred8.asm	Fri Apr 25 11:01:56 2014 +0800
@@ -1156,7 +1156,7 @@
     RET
 
 INIT_XMM sse4
-cglobal intra_pred_ang8_3, 3,5,7
+cglobal intra_pred_ang8_3, 3,5,8
     cmp         r4m,       byte 33
     cmove       r2,        r3mp
     lea         r3,        [ang_table + 14 * 16]
@@ -1240,7 +1240,7 @@
 
     RET
 
-cglobal intra_pred_ang8_4, 3,5,7
+cglobal intra_pred_ang8_4, 3,5,8
     cmp         r4m,       byte 32
     cmove       r2,        r3mp
     lea         r3,        [ang_table + 19 * 16]
@@ -1724,7 +1724,7 @@
     packuswb    m1,        m0
     jmp         mangle(private_prefix %+ _ %+ intra_pred_ang8_3 %+ SUFFIX %+ .transpose8x8)
 
-cglobal intra_pred_ang8_14, 4,5,7
+cglobal intra_pred_ang8_14, 4,5,8
     cmp         r4m,       byte 22
     jnz         .skip
     xchg        r2,        r3
@@ -1773,7 +1773,7 @@
     packuswb    m1,        m0
     jmp         mangle(private_prefix %+ _ %+ intra_pred_ang8_3 %+ SUFFIX %+ .transpose8x8)
 
-cglobal intra_pred_ang8_15, 4,5,7
+cglobal intra_pred_ang8_15, 4,5,8
     cmp         r4m,       byte 21
     jnz         .skip
     xchg        r2,        r3
@@ -1877,7 +1877,7 @@
     packuswb    m1,        m0
     jmp         mangle(private_prefix %+ _ %+ intra_pred_ang8_3 %+ SUFFIX %+ .transpose8x8)
 
-cglobal intra_pred_ang8_17, 4,5,7
+cglobal intra_pred_ang8_17, 4,5,8
     cmp         r4m,       byte 19
     jnz         .skip
     xchg        r2,        r3



More information about the x265-devel mailing list